Full description
In our previous study, volumetric fat loss was noted in the 3 fatty laminae of dorsal hands during aging; the dorsal intermediate lamina (DIL) showed the greatest progressive fat loss after the age of 30. Volumetric rejuvenation of the 3 laminae may result in the most aesthetic appearance, especially in women. It is necessary to develop precise rejuvenation therapies according to the aging process of the dorsum of the hands that will yield the most aesthetic appearance.
